DVSF is a forum for middle and high school students to display scientific research and engineering projects that they have completed. The fairs connect these hard working and inventive young minds with professionals in their fields. Through interviews and project evaluation, the students gain insight into new directions for their research and learn new ways of thinking, often finding mentors and a
dvisers to help them develop their project further. Winners of the DVSF competition receive recognition, scholarships, and monetary prizes, as well as the chance to compete in the Regeneron International Science and Engineering Fair. DVSF provides resources to support student research, including free mentoring and free workshops for teachers.
